You are the first step.'In a silverware shop, a young wife works alongside her husband.�Amid growing political turmoil, Bea finds solace in the local marsh, where she is visited recurrently by a mysterious presence, logging each appearance carefully in a scarlet journal. �In a time like now, Kay navigates friendship, queerness and the temporary job market, whilst contemplating the significance of her life in a world with such an uncertain future. At her grandmother's house she finds an intriguing record of an angel's visits. �A hundred years into the future, outsiders have banded together to live off-grid away from a corrupt government and a city wracked by oppression and climate change. When Ess is chosen for a virgin mission, a journey into the past to save the present, she is guided only by a well-thumbed red notebook.�Set against the shifting landscape of�East London�marshes and expanding over three centuries, this is the breathtaking, urgent story of three women separated by history but threaded together by unknown forces. ��`An inventive, ambitious novel.'
